😐A single person spends $2,056 per month in Oldham vs $1,031 in Medellin, rent included.
😐A couple spends around $3,034 per month in Oldham vs $1,599 in Medellin, rent included.
😐A family of three spends $4,013 per month in Oldham vs $2,167 in Medellin, rent included.
😐Oldham costs about 99% more than Medellin, driven mainly by Eating Out.
📊Oldham sits 54% above the global median, while Medellin is 23% below – they fall on opposite sides of the world average.

🏠A central one-bedroom costs $1,199 in Oldham versus $477 in Medellin.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.
💰Salaries run about 298% higher in Oldham, which partly offsets the higher cost of living there. Purchasing power depends on which expenses matter most to you.
🛒A mid-range dinner for two costs $90.0 in Oldham versus $33.00 in Medellin. Monthly groceries follow the same trend: $328 vs $193 – making Medellin the more affordable choice for daily food spending.

Oldham vs Medellin: Cost of Living - Frequently Asked Questions
Is Medellin cheaper than Oldham?
Yes – Oldham is pricier by about 99%, and the gap shows up most in Eating Out. It's not just housing either; the difference applies across most spending categories.
What income do you need for each city?
For a comfortable life, plan on about $3,084 per month in Oldham and $1,546 in Medellin. That covers rent, food, utilities, transport, and enough left over to feel settled – not just surviving.
Which city has lower housing costs?
Rent is clearly cheaper in Medellin, especially for central apartments. Housing is actually the single biggest factor behind the overall cost gap between these two cities.
Is eating out cheaper in Oldham or in Medellin?
A mid-range dinner for two costs $90.0 in Oldham and $33.00 in Medellin. That's a good indicator of the overall restaurant and café pricing gap between the two cities.
What are total monthly expenses in Oldham and in Medellin?
Monthly expenses with rent come to $2,056 in Oldham and $1,031 in Medellin. The difference isn't just one category – it shows up across housing, food, transport, and services.
Is $1,500 a realistic budget for living in Oldham or in Medellin?
A $1,500 monthly budget goes further in Medellin, where all-in costs run around $1,031, than in Oldham at $2,056. In Medellin it covers expenses comfortably, while in Oldham it requires careful planning or may not stretch far enough.
Is Oldham or Medellin more family-friendly?
Families tend to lean toward Medellin – lower housing and cheaper childcare make a real difference, especially on a single income or when paying for private education.
